package com.whyc.mapper;
|
|
import org.apache.ibatis.annotations.Param;
|
|
import java.util.List;
|
|
/**
|
* 通用mapper,用于通用数据的查询
|
*/
|
public interface CommonMapper {
|
|
/**
|
* @param schema dbName
|
* @param table tableName
|
* @param field 这个字段对应的值类型为数值,则valuePrefix为null,如果不为数值,valuePrefix必须指定非数值的前缀
|
//* @param valuePrefix null | String
|
* @return
|
*/
|
//Object getMaxValue(String schema,String table,String field,String valuePrefix);
|
Object getMaxValue(@Param("schema") String schema,@Param("table") String table,@Param("field") String field);
|
|
String existTable(String dbName, String tableName);
|
|
//void truncate(String dbName, String tableName);
|
|
//void createTable4AlarmVoiceSet();
|
|
//void createTable4UserLogByYear(@Param("year") String year);
|
|
//void insertBatch4UserLogByYear(@Param("year")String year, List<UserLog> userLogs);
|
|
//void createTable4PowerAlarmHistoryByYear(@Param("year") String year);
|
|
//void insertBatch4PowerAlarmHistoryByYear(String year, List<PwrdevAlarmHistory> temp);
|
|
//void createTable4BattAlarmDataHistoryByYear(@Param("year") String year);
|
|
//void insertBatch4BattAlarmDataHistoryByYear(String year, List<BattalarmDataHistory> temp);
|
|
//void createTable4DevAlarmDataHistoryByYear(@Param("year") String year);
|
|
//void insertBatch4DevAlarmDataHistoryByYear(String year, List<DevalarmDataHistory> temp);
|
|
//void createBattState_RT_RamDB_Table();
|
|
//void updateTb_App_Sys_AppServerTable();
|
|
List<String> getTableListLike(String dbName, String tableLike);
|
|
// void createTable4UpsDataHistory(String tableName);
|
|
}
|